02.11.2023 Игорь Борисенко 4040
Импорт данных из любых внешних систем, поддер...

Содержание:


Интеграция – важнейшая способность современных информационных систем (ИС). Существует несколько технологий интеграции, например, файловый обмен, прямое подключение, интернет-сервисы. Рассмотрим особенности использования прямого подключения на примере ADO-обменов.   


1.     Область применения ADO на платформе системы 1С: Предприятие

 

ADO – это специальный интерфейс доступа к данным. Поэтому первое и очевидное ограничение: интегрируемые ИС должны поддерживать ADO на уровне платформы системы 1С: Предприятие. Информационная система, которая выступает источником данных, должна этот интерфейс предоставлять, а система – приемник, должна уметь этим интерфейсом пользоваться. Как правило, все продукты Microsoft этот интерфейс поддерживают (это их разработка).


Второе ограничение: чтобы воспользоваться интерфейсом ADO, нужно установить соединение с платформой ИС-Источника, а это означает, ИС-источник должна быть установлена и доступна на стороне функционирования ИС-приемника. Иными словами, чтобы через ADO прочитать excel-файл, должен быть установлен MS Excel.


В силу этих двух ограничений ADO проигрывает веб-сервисам, с которыми для ИС-приемника вообще неважно, какое ПО выступает в качестве ИС-источника, и где этот источник располагается.


А к преимуществам ADO относится то, что через ADO-интерфейс ИС-источник предоставляет для ИС-приемника практически всю свою функциональность по работе с данными. И, таким образом, платформа системы 1С: Предприятие может получить доступ ко всем данным и всю функциональность как минимум продуктов Microsoft, например, работать с таблицами MS SQL.   

   

2.     Алгоритм практической реализации и COM-соединение 1С

 

Использование технологии ADO включает следующие шаги:


•        Создание соединения с ИС-источником (через ADODB.Connection)


•        Отправка команды для ИС-источника (через ADODB.Command)

-     Именно здесь доступна вся функциональность ИС-источника, все ее возможности по работе с данными; например, для из 1С в MS SQL можно передать произвольный SQL-запрос


•    Получение результата от ИС-источника и его обработка на стороне ИС-приемника (например, через ADODB.RecordSet)


•        Закрытие соединения с ИС-источником


1С своей платформой поддерживает аналог ADO: так называемое прямое подключение через COMConnector 1С. Назначение и алгоритм практической реализации у COM-соединения 1С такие же, как и у ADO, разве что область применения ограничена лишь системами на платформе 1С.


Итак, платформа системы 1С: Предприятие поддерживает подключение к интерфейсу ADO и, таким образом, расширяет свои интеграционные возможности.

    

Специалист компании ООО "Кодерлайн"

 Игорь Борисенко

Наши проекты

Внедрение ПП "1С:Корпоративный инструментальный пакет 8" в ООО «Торговый Дом Факел»
ООО «Торговый Дом Факел»

Отрасль:
Производство

Внедренное типовое решение:
1С:Предприятие 8. ERP Управление предприятием 2

Различная отраслевая специфика:
- Переработка давальческого сырья
- Уче...

ООО "НЦКТ"
ООО "НЦКТ"

Отрасль:
Профессиональные услуги

Внедренное типовое решение:
1С:Бухгалтерия 8 ПРОФ

Производственные операции
Автоматизация бизнес-процессов...

ООО «ДАФ Тракс Рус» (DAF Trucks Rus)
ООО «ДАФ Тракс Рус» (DAF Trucks Rus)

Отрасль:
Машиностроение

Внедренное типовое решение:
«1С:Управление корпоративными финансами»

- Осуществлена разработка матрицы прав и ролей для финансового подразделени...

Группа компаний ТМ «Дружба народов»
Группа компаний ТМ «Дружба народов»

Отрасль:
Пищевая промышленность

Внедренное типовое решение:
1С:ERP Управление предприятием 2.1

- Переход на новый релиз 2.1 программы «1С:ERP Управление предприятием»
- Разра...

ООО «Фипар»
ООО «Фипар»

Отрасль:

Внедренное типовое решение:
1С:Предприятие 8. ERP Управление предприятием 2

Специалисты «Кодерлайн» внедрили «1С:ERP. Управление предприятием 2» и автома...

ООО «Лаборатория успеха»
ООО «Лаборатория успеха»

Отрасль:
Общественное и плановое питание, гостиничный бизнес, туризм

Внедренное типовое решение:
1С:Управление холдингом 8

Бухгалтерский учет;
Расчет зарплаты и кадровый учет;...

Внедрение ПП "1С:Управление небольшой фирмой 8 ПРОФ" в
ИП Любо Виктория Александровна (ООО «Рекреация»)

Отрасль:
Производство

Внедренное типовое решение:
1С:Управление небольшой фирмой 8 ПРОФ

Осуществлены разработки:
– отчета по спецификации Заказа;
– загрузки сп...

Внедрение системы финансового учета БИТ:Финанс
ООО «Алькор и Ко» (Л’Этуаль)

Отрасль:
Торговля

Внедренное типовое решение:
БИТ.Финанс

- Финансовый учет;
- Поддержка проекта внедрения МСФО;
- Регламентные рабо...

Внедрение «1С:Зарплата и управление персоналом 8 КОРП» в компании «ПБК»
ООО «Партнер Бухгалтер Консультант»

Отрасль:
Бухгалтерские услуги

Внедренное типовое решение:
1С:Зарплата и управление персоналом

- Интеграция продукта с базой данных оперативного учета Axapta;
- Доработка фу...

ООО «ЛукБелОйл»
ООО «ЛукБелОйл»

Отрасль:
Нефтегазовая отрасль

Внедренное типовое решение:

- Обследовании бизнес-процессов «Документооборот», «Казначейство и Бюджети...

1с-РАРУС МСК
1с-РАРУС МСК

Отрасль:
Разработка компьютерного программного обеспечения

Внедренное типовое решение:

- Совместная работа по внедрению разных решений, в том числе «1С:ERP Управление...

ООО ХДМ Рус
ООО ХДМ Рус

Отрасль:
Торговля

Внедренное типовое решение:
1С:Бухгалтерия ПРОФ

Бухгалтерский учет Банк и касса Расчеты с контрагентами Торговые операции ...

Наши соц. сети

Telegram-канал «Koderline 1С» Группа в Вконтакте «Кодерлайн КОРП» Rutube

Остались вопросы - обратитесь к нам!

Впишите свои Имя и Телефон, чтобы мы ответили на все интересующие Вас вопросы.
ФИО*
E-mail*
Телефон*
Сообщение